titleOfInvention Hall effect current sensor for an aerosol delivery device
abstract An aerosol delivery device is provided that includes a housing defining a reservoir configured to retain aerosol precursor composition. The aerosol delivery device also includes a plurality of electronic components interconnected by or connected to one or more conductors, and these electronic components include a heating element, a control component and a Hall effect current sensor. The control component is configured to operate in an active mode in which the control component is configured to control the heating element to activate and vaporize components of the aerosol precursor composition. The Hall effect current sensor is positioned proximate a conductor of the one or more conductors, and configured to measure to a current through the conductor. And the control component is configured to control operation of at least one functional element of the aerosol delivery device in response to the current so measured.
